These people develop new ways to produce materials.
The things you could do:
- Develop new automated assembly machines.
- Develop new products.
- Develop new computer chips.
- Research ways to make a product work differently.
| Maintenance, Installation & Repair |
[-] |
These people keep manufacturing equipment in working
order.
The things you could do:
- Repair machinery.
- Specialize in plumbing or pipe repair/installation.
- Install electrical equipment.
- Specialize in repair/installation of computer networks in factories.

| Logistics & Inventory Control |
[-] |
These people move materials within a company and also
to other companies.
The things you could do:
- Monitor inventories of needed parts.
- Move materials within a production plant.
- Schedule shipping and distribution of your product.
- Manage a team of delivery drivers.
| Health, Safety and Environmental Assurance |
[-] |
These people help prevent accidents in manufacturing
facilities.
The things you could do:
- Monitor levels of pollutants in water used in your
process.
- Educate workers on health and safety regulations.
- Help a company comply with regulations.
- Monitor safe practices throughout a factory.
